+While there is a SQL standard, most SQL engines support a variation of that standard. This makes it difficult
+to write portable SQL code. SQLGlot bridges all the different variations, called "dialects", with an extensible
+SQL transpilation framework.

+The base `sqlglot.dialects.dialect.Dialect` class implements a generic dialect that aims to be as universal as possible.
+Each SQL variation has its own `Dialect` subclass, extending the corresponding `Tokenizer`, `Parser` and `Generator`
+classes as needed.
